QH - 6015FB High-speed Dual-platform Enclosed type Sheet Laser Cutting Machine
Description
The QH-6015FB is a high-performance sheet metal processing solution engineered for high-speed batch production, with its 1.5G maximum linkage acceleration as the core driver—enabling rapid start-stop, path traversal, and direction changes to minimize idle time. It integrates dual-platform alternating operation and an enclosed structure, making it ideal for industries like construction machinery, large household appliances, and heavy-duty hardware that demand both speed, safety, and continuous processing.

Technical Specifications
Processing Area 6000 * 1500mm
Maximum Loading Weight 1000kg
Machine Weight 3500kg
Overall Dimensions 8500×2280×2150mm
Laser Power Range 1500W - 20KW
X/Y-axis Positioning Accuracy ±0.03mm
X/Y-axis Repositioning Accuracy ±0.03mm
Maximum Linkage Acceleration 1.5G
Maximum Linkage Speed 100m/min
Transmission System Double rack & pinion transmission with servo drive
Voltage Requirement 380V
Frequency 50Hz


Advantage

1.5G Acceleration + Dual Platforms = Uninterrupted High-Speed Production: The 1.5G acceleration minimizes time spent on workpiece positioning and path transitions, while dual alternating platforms allow one platform to process at high speed (100m/min) while the other loads/unloads. This eliminates downtime between batches—for example, processing 50pcs of 5m×1.2m steel plates takes 25% less time than single-platform machines, directly boosting daily output.

High Speed Without Precision Loss: Thanks to the double rack & pinion servo transmission, the machine retains ±0.03mm X/Y-axis accuracy even at 1.5G acceleration. Unlike low-stability high-speed cutters that produce burrs or misaligned cuts, it delivers smooth, consistent edges across large workpieces (e.g., 6m-long appliance panels), reducing post-processing needs and scrap rates by 25%-30%.

Enclosed Design Supports Stable High-Speed Longevity: The enclosed structure blocks workshop dust from entering the transmission system—critical for maintaining 1.5G acceleration’s stability over time. Its 3500kg heavy-duty frame absorbs vibration generated by high acceleration, preventing wear on gears and guides, which extends component lifespan by 40% compared to lightweight high-speed machines.

Large-Area High-Speed Versatility: The 6000×1500mm processing area lets the 1.5G acceleration shine on large workpieces (e.g., construction machinery frames) by cutting down traversal time across the entire platform. Combined with 1500W-20KW laser power, it handles thin (0.5mm aluminum) and thick (25mm carbon steel) materials at high speed, eliminating the need for separate machines for different workpiece sizes or thicknesses.
